Gwaihir posted:Pros: Infantry without fire resistant armor that end their turn in a burning hex are BBQ'd. IIRC that's checked in the end phase. So it's entirely possible to let the ACE elementals move and then target their hex to set it on fire while they're in it. Notably for the people with plasma weapons. And even if you can't see them, you can probably make some reasonable guesses as to where they most likely went and light those hexes up. Force them into the open.

Re-Engineered Laser. Bigger, heavier, higher heat, but it does more damage and ignores all specialty armors (including Hardened and Ferro-Lamellor). It also gets a -1 to hit.
